Responsibilities and Duties:

Be able to provide semi-professional technical support for engineers working in such areas as research, design, development, testing, or manufacturing process improvement. Work pertains to electrical, electronic, or mechanical components or equipment. These technicians are required to have some practical knowledge of science or engineering. Some positions may require a practical knowledge of mathematics or computer science. Included are workers who prepare design drawings and assist with the design, evaluation, and/or modification of machinery and equipment.

Required Qualifications, Skills and Experience:

  • High school/vocational school diploma or GED certificate
  • The Engineering Technician I performs simple routine tasks under close supervision or from detailed procedures. Work is checked in progress or on completion.
  • The Engineering Technician I will perform one or a combination of such typical duties as:
    • Assembling or installing equipment or parts requiring simple wiring, soldering, or connecting.
    • Performing simple or routine tasks or tests, such as tensile or hardness tests; operating and adjusting simple test equipment; and recording test data.
    • Gathering and maintaining specified records of engineering data such as tests, drawings, etc.; performing computations by substituting numbers in specified formulas; plotting data and drawing simple curves and graphs.
